
Čtvrtá hvězda (2014)
Štěpán got a job as a night receptionist in a three star Hotel Meteor on the periphery of Prague. He'd like to get along with the colleagues and not attract the attention of his superiors. But how is he supposed to do that, when he desperately falls in love with Pavlínka, who works as a day receptionist? They see each other only in the moment when the shifts change! On top of that, Pavlínka is not interested in Stepán but in the aggressive hotel maintenance man David. He is in turn interested in two things only: how has his beloved Sparta played and how to avoid the exhausting erotic interest of his superior, the ambitious hotel manager Tereza. Tereza does her best to improve the quality of the hotel and get the long-wished-for fourth star. This concern clashes with the selfishness, indolence, laziness, acquisitiveness and cunning of the subordinates. Of all the hotel employees, the fourth star is of the least interest to her ex-husband Theodor, the director of the hotel. His only interest is to perfect his skills in playing the Chinese game of mahjong. Tereza's efforts are being thwarted by the personal interests of other subordinates, too: the ambitious and treacherous cook Smutný craves the position of the chef, the melancholic chef Tichý struggles with losing his taste as a result of work accident, the day receptionist Frantisek deals with the underworld and consorts with the dangerous criminal Major, the hotel prostitute Libuska trains a junior lacrosse team, the hotel taxi driver Jindra is a gay man with a strong maternal instinct and Jirina the barmaid has a deficit.
